Killona, Louisiana

Killona is a census-designated place (CDP) in St. Charles Parish, Louisiana, United States. The population was 724 in 2020. On December 14, 2022, the town was hit by a destructive and deadly EF2 tornado that damaged or destroyed numerous structures, killed one person, and injured eight others.

Demographics
Killona was first listed as a census designated place in the 2000 U.S. census. In 2000, Killona's population was 797. By the 2020 census, its population declined to 724. ==Education==

Places of interest
Killona is home to the following: • Killona Plantation — Former plantation that held enslaved Africans, after emancipation Black Americans were held there in 'peonage' until 1970s. • Waterford 3 — Operated by Entergy Nuclear, Waterford Nuclear Generating Station (aka Waterford 3), produces roughly 10% of power for the state of Louisiana. ==References==
